- 摘要:
- 以“循化红”线辣椒为试材,采用单因素试验,研究了“地乐谷丰”牌酵素有机肥、尿素、磷酸二铵、进口美国硫酸钾50%等不同肥料类型对减轻循化线辣椒连作障碍的影响。结果表明:施用农家有机肥、酵素有机肥和氯化钾可以增加辣椒的株高、茎粗、有效分枝数、地上部展开度,红果率,降低始花节位,提高循化线辣椒的果实产量;其中农家有机肥的增加效果显著,酵素有机肥和氯化钾增加效果较低;增施农家有机肥可以较大幅度降低线辣椒的连作障碍,而酵素有机肥和氯化钾降低线辣椒的连作障碍作用较小;增施农家肥60 t/hm2、农家肥60 t/hm2+氯化钾300 kg/hm2可以有效降低循化线辣椒的连作障碍,获得较高的经济产量和更高的经济效益。
- Abstract:
- Taking Xunhua line pepper as material,single factor test was used to study the effects of different fertilizer type(enzyme orgainc fertilizer,urea,phosphorus diamine fertilizer,potassium sulfate) on lightening the barriers of continuous cropping of Xunhua line pepper.The results showed that the application of farm organic fertilizer,enzyme organic fertilizer and potassium chloride could increase plant height,stem diameter,number of effective branches,expand degrees of aboveground,red rate,lower first flower node,increase fruit yield of pepper Xunhua line.The effect of farm organic fertilizer was significant and that of enzyme organic fertilizer and potassium chloride was relatively low,farm organic fertilizer could greatly reduce the cropping obstacles of line pepper and enzyme organic fertilizer and potassium chloride could not greatly reduce.To achieve a higher economic yield and economic benefit and effectively reducing cropping obstacles of Xunhua line pepper,the recommended amount of fertilizer was that farm organic fertilizer 60 t/hm2,enzyme organic fertilizer 60 t/hm2+potassium chloride 300 kg/hm2.
